Each year, White Mountain Enterprises (WME) prepares a reconciliation schedule that compares its income statement with its statement of cash flows on both the direct and indirect method bases. In its 2018 income statement, WME reported a $40,000 loss on the sale of equipment. In its reconciliation schedule, WME should:
A) Report a $40,000 cash outflow for the direct method.
B) Show a $40,000 positive adjustment to net income under the indirect method.
C) Show a $40,000 negative adjustment to net income under the indirect method.
D) None of these answer choices are correct.
